This five-day instructor-led course provides students with product knowledge and skills needed to maintain a Microsoft SQL Server 2005 database. The course focuses on teaching individuals how to use SQL Server 2005 product features and tools related to maintaining a database.
Prerequisites:
- Basic knowledge of the Microsoft Windows operating system and its core functionality
- Working knowledge of Transact-SQL
- Working knowledge of relational databases
- Some experience with database design
In addition, it is recommended, but not required, that students have completed:
- SQL200 Transact-SQL Programming
Audience:
This course is intended for IT Professionals who want to become skilled on SQL Server 2005 product features and technologies for maintaining a database.
Topics covered:
- Installing and Configuring SQL Server 2005
- Managing Databases and Files
- Managing Security
- Disaster Recovery
- Monitoring SQL Server
- Transferring Data
- Implementing Replication
- Automating Administrative Tasks
- Maintaining High Availability
At course completion:
Students will be able to:
- Install and configure SQL Server 2005
- Manage database files
- Backup and restore databases
- Manage security
- Monitor SQL Server
- Transfer data in and out of SQL Server
- Automate administrative tasks
- Replicate data between SQL Server instances
- Maintain high availability
